While Woodgrange Park may not boast an extensive range of amenities, it does provide essential services to ensure a comfortable travel experience. Tickets can be easily purchased and collected from on-site machines, which are accessible to all travelers, including those with disabilities. For those with hearing impairments, the induction loop system allows for smoother communication. However, travelers should note the absence of refreshment facilities and waiting lounges, so planning ahead is suggested if you're in need of a snack or a place to rest before your journey.
The station takes pride in its step-free access, creating an inclusive environment for travelers of all capabilities. CCTV cameras cover both the bicycle storage area and the station to ensure passenger safety. Regrettably, there are no available accessible taxis or parking spaces specifically designated for those with mobility impairments, so it may be wise to plan accordingly if special arrangements are needed. Fortunately, trained staff are present to offer on-the-spot assistance and general inquiries seven days a week, ensuring your journey with the Overground is as smooth as possible.
Strategically positioned, Woodgrange Park provides seamless travel connections via both rail replacement bus services and proximity to nearby metro stations. For those seeking to continue their journeys eastward to Barking or westward towards Walthamstow Central, there are convenient bus services just down the road from the station. Meanwhile, Manor Park's National Rail station is a short 7-minute walk away, affording you further travel options. Small Heath Station offers essential services to facilitate your journey. The ticket office operates on weekdays from 07:00 to 10:00, ensuring you can grab a last-minute ticket or seek help if needed.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available, and you can collect tickets purchased online here too. It's worth noting that while the station is fitted with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, it lacks step-free access—a crucial point for travelers with mobility needs.
Even though Small Heath Station doesn't have a waiting room, there are seating areas to ensure comfort while you wait. Additionally, CCTV coverage throughout the station helps in ensuring passenger security. While there are no refreshment facilities or shops here, the vibrancy of Birmingham ensures you'll find plenty of those in the vicinity.
Small Heath's connectivity spans beyond trains, with various travel options available. Rail replacement services, when required, operate from the front of the station, making it easy for passengers to switch travel modes without a hitch. Taxis are readily available with local services like Heartlands and Silverline offering convenient pick-up and drop-off options. For the eco-conscious or budget traveler, local bus services provide an excellent way to navigate Birmingham's sights and sounds.
